Classic Turkey Stew With Herb Dumplings

Turkey stew with fluffy dumplings is a comforting and hearty dish that is perfect for chilly days. This classic recipe combines tender turkey meat and an array of vegetables simmered in a flavorful broth, all topped with light and fluffy herb dumplings that add a delightful texture. It’s a true one-pot meal that warms the soul and brings family and friends together.
| Ingredients | Quantity |
|---|---|
| Cooked turkey meat | 2 cups, shredded |
| Olive oil | 2 tablespoons |
| Onion | 1, chopped |
| Carrots | 2, diced |
| Celery | 2 stalks, diced |
| Garlic | 2 cloves, minced |
| Chicken broth | 4 cups |
| Dried thyme | 1 teaspoon |
| Dried rosemary | 1 teaspoon |
| Salt | To taste |
| Black pepper | To taste |
| Fresh parsley | 2 tablespoons, chopped |
| All-purpose flour | 1 cup |
| Baking powder | 1 tablespoon |
| Milk | ½ cup |
| Butter | 2 tablespoons, melted |
| Fresh herbs (optional) | For garnish |
Cooking Steps:
- In a large pot, heat olive oil over medium heat, then sauté the onion, carrots, and celery until softened.
- Add garlic and cook for an additional minute before stirring in the turkey, chicken broth, thyme, rosemary, salt, and pepper. Simmer for 20 minutes.
- In a separate bowl, mix flour, baking powder, salt, and parsley. Stir in milk and melted butter until just combined.
- Drop spoonfuls of the dumpling batter onto the simmering stew. Cover and cook for 15-20 minutes until dumplings are fluffy.
- Serve hot, garnished with fresh herbs if desired. Enjoy your comforting turkey stew with fluffy dumplings!

Creamy Turkey and Mushroom Stew

Creamy turkey and mushroom stew is a rich and satisfying dish that combines tender turkey meat with earthy mushrooms in a luscious, creamy sauce. This hearty stew is perfect for cozy dinners and can be served over rice or with crusty bread for a complete meal.
| Ingredients | Quantity |
|---|---|
| Cooked turkey meat | 2 cups, shredded |
| Olive oil | 2 tablespoons |
| Onion | 1, chopped |
| Garlic | 2 cloves, minced |
| Mushrooms | 8 oz, sliced |
| Chicken broth | 3 cups |
| Heavy cream | 1 cup |
| Dried thyme | 1 teaspoon |
| Salt | To taste |
| Black pepper | To taste |
| Fresh parsley | 2 tablespoons, chopped |
| Cornstarch (optional) | 1 tablespoon (to thicken) |
Cooking Steps:
- In a large pot, heat olive oil over medium heat, then sauté the onions and garlic until fragrant.
- Add sliced mushrooms and cook until they begin to soften, about 5 minutes.
- Stir in the shredded turkey, chicken broth, heavy cream, thyme, salt, and pepper. Bring to a simmer.
- If desired, mix cornstarch with a little water and stir it into the pot to thicken the stew.
- Cook for an additional 10-15 minutes, allowing flavors to meld. Serve hot, garnished with fresh parsley. Enjoy!

Turkey and Vegetable Stew With Biscuit Dumplings

Turkey and vegetable stew with biscuit dumplings is a delightful variation of traditional turkey stew, featuring a blend of fresh vegetables and topped with hearty biscuit dumplings. This dish is perfect for those looking for a cozy meal that combines the rich flavors of turkey and seasonal produce, all while providing the satisfying texture of fluffy dumplings.
| Ingredients | Quantity |
|---|---|
| Cooked turkey meat | 2 cups, shredded |
| Olive oil | 2 tablespoons |
| Onion | 1, chopped |
| Carrots | 2, sliced |
| Celery | 2 stalks, sliced |
| Garlic | 2 cloves, minced |
| Chicken broth | 4 cups |
| Dried thyme | 1 teaspoon |
| Salt | To taste |
| Black pepper | To taste |
| Frozen peas | 1 cup |
| Fresh parsley | 2 tablespoons, chopped |
| All-purpose flour | 2 cups |
| Baking powder | 1 tablespoon |
| Milk | 1 cup |
| Butter | 1/4 cup, melted |
| Granulated sugar | 1 tablespoon |
Cooking Steps:
- In a large pot, heat olive oil over medium heat, then sauté the onion, carrots, celery, and garlic until softened.
- Add the shredded turkey, chicken broth, thyme, salt, and pepper; bring to a simmer and stir in the frozen peas.
- In a bowl, combine flour, baking powder, milk, melted butter, and sugar to make a dough for the biscuit dumplings.
- Drop spoonfuls of the biscuit mixture onto the simmering stew.
- Cover and simmer for 15-20 minutes until the biscuit dumplings are cooked through and fluffy. Garnish with fresh parsley before serving. Enjoy!

Italian Turkey Stew With Parmesan Dumplings

Italian turkey stew with Parmesan dumplings is a comforting and flavorful dish that combines tender turkey meat with a hearty tomato-based stew, enhanced with Italian herbs. The Parmesan dumplings add a delightful cheesy flavor and fluffy texture that beautifully complements the rich stew. This dish is perfect for a family dinner or a cozy evening at home.
| Ingredients | Quantity |
|---|---|
| Cooked turkey meat | 2 cups, shredded |
| Olive oil | 2 tablespoons |
| Onion | 1, chopped |
| Carrots | 2, sliced |
| Bell pepper | 1, diced |
| Garlic | 2 cloves, minced |
| Chicken broth | 4 cups |
| Diced tomatoes (canned) | 1 can (14.5 oz) |
| Dried oregano | 1 teaspoon |
| Dried basil | 1 teaspoon |
| Salt | To taste |
| Black pepper | To taste |
| Fresh spinach | 2 cups, chopped |
| All-purpose flour | 1 cup |
| Grated Parmesan cheese | 1/2 cup |
| Baking powder | 1 tablespoon |
| Milk | 1/2 cup |
| Butter | 1/4 cup, melted |
| Granulated sugar | 1 teaspoon |
Cooking Steps:
- In a large pot, heat olive oil over medium heat, and sauté the onion, carrots, bell pepper, and garlic until softened.
- Add the shredded turkey, chicken broth, diced tomatoes, oregano, basil, salt, and pepper; bring to a simmer, and stir in the fresh spinach.
- In a separate bowl, combine flour, Parmesan cheese, baking powder, milk, melted butter, and sugar to make a dough for the dumplings.
- Drop spoonfuls of the Parmesan dumpling mixture into the simmering stew.
- Cover and simmer for 15-20 minutes until the dumplings are cooked through and fluffy. Serve hot and enjoy!

Southwest Turkey Stew With Cornmeal Dumplings

Southwest Turkey Stew with Cornmeal Dumplings is a hearty and spicy dish that brings the flavors of the southwest to your table. This stew is packed with tender turkey, colorful vegetables, and a zesty tomato base, while the cornmeal dumplings provide a delightful, slightly sweet contrast that enhances the overall flavor profile. This dish is perfect for a cozy night or any gathering with friends and family.
| Ingredients | Quantity |
|---|---|
| Cooked turkey meat | 2 cups, shredded |
| Olive oil | 2 tablespoons |
| Onion | 1, chopped |
| Bell peppers | 2, diced (any color) |
| Zucchini | 1, diced |
| Corn (frozen or canned) | 1 cup |
| Garlic | 2 cloves, minced |
| Chicken broth | 4 cups |
| Diced tomatoes (canned) | 1 can (14.5 oz) |
| Chili powder | 1 tablespoon |
| Cumin | 1 teaspoon |
| Salt | To taste |
| Black pepper | To taste |
| Fresh cilantro | 1/4 cup, chopped |
| Cornmeal | 1 cup |
| All-purpose flour | 1/2 cup |
| Baking powder | 1 tablespoon |
| Milk | 3/4 cup |
| Butter | 1/4 cup, melted |
| Granulated sugar | 1 teaspoon |
Cooking Steps:
- In a large pot, heat olive oil over medium heat; sauté the onion, bell peppers, zucchini, and garlic until softened.
- Add the shredded turkey, broth, diced tomatoes, corn, chili powder, cumin, salt, and pepper; bring to a simmer.
- In a separate bowl, combine cornmeal, flour, baking powder, milk, melted butter, and sugar to form a dumpling batter.
- Drop spoonfuls of the cornmeal dumpling mixture into the simmering stew.
- Cover and simmer for about 15-20 minutes until the dumplings are cooked through. Garnish with fresh cilantro before serving. Enjoy!

Mediterranean Turkey Stew With Feta Dumplings

Mediterranean Turkey Stew with Feta Dumplings is a vibrant and flavorful dish that brings together tender turkey meat, a medley of Mediterranean vegetables, and zestful feta cheese dumplings. This stew is not only hearty and comforting but also offers a delightful twist with its impressive Mediterranean flavors, making it a perfect meal for family gatherings or chilly nights.
| Ingredients | Quantity |
|---|---|
| Cooked turkey meat | 2 cups, shredded |
| Chicken broth | 4 cups |
| Onion | 1, chopped |
| Bell pepper | 1, diced |
| Zucchini | 1, diced |
| Garlic | 2 cloves, minced |
| Oregano | 1 teaspoon |
| Paprika | 1 teaspoon |
| Salt | To taste |
| Black pepper | To taste |
| Flour | 2 cups |
| Baking powder | 1 tablespoon |
| Milk | 1 cup |
| Eggs | 2 |
| Feta cheese | 1 cup, crumbled |
| Fresh parsley | 1/4 cup, chopped |
Cooking Steps:
- In a large pot, sauté the onion, bell pepper, zucchini, and garlic until softened.
- Add the shredded turkey, chicken broth, oregano, paprika, salt, and pepper; bring to a simmer.
- Cover and cook for 20 minutes to allow flavors to blend.
- In a separate bowl, combine flour, baking powder, milk, eggs, and crumbled feta to create a dough.
- Drop spoonfuls of the feta dumpling mixture into the simmering stew.
- Cover and cook for an additional 15 minutes until the dumplings are fluffy and cooked through.
- Serve hot, garnished with fresh parsley, and enjoy your Mediterranean-inspired flavors!

Asian Turkey Stew With Ginger Scallion Dumplings

Asian Turkey Stew with Ginger Scallion Dumplings is a warming and aromatic dish that melds tender turkey meat with a symphony of Asian flavors. The stew features a rich broth infused with ginger and soy sauce, complemented by soft and fluffy dumplings made with scallions. Perfect for cozy dinners or as a comforting dish on a cold day, this stew promises to bring a taste of East Asia to your table.
| Ingredients | Quantity |
|---|---|
| Cooked turkey meat | 2 cups, shredded |
| Chicken broth | 4 cups |
| Onion | 1, chopped |
| Carrots | 2, sliced |
| Bell pepper | 1, diced |
| Garlic | 3 cloves, minced |
| Ginger | 1 tablespoon, grated |
| Soy sauce | 1/4 cup |
| Sesame oil | 2 tablespoons |
| Salt | To taste |
| Black pepper | To taste |
| All-purpose flour | 2 cups |
| Baking powder | 1 tablespoon |
| Milk | 1 cup |
| Eggs | 1 |
| Scallions | 1/2 cup, chopped |
Cooking Steps:
- In a large pot, heat sesame oil and sauté the onion, carrots, bell pepper, garlic, and ginger until softened.
- Add the shredded turkey, chicken broth, soy sauce, salt, and pepper; bring to a simmer.
- Cover and cook for 20 minutes to let the flavors meld.
- In a separate bowl, mix flour, baking powder, milk, and egg to form a batter; fold in chopped scallions.
- Drop spoonfuls of the scallion dumpling mixture into the simmering stew.
- Cover and cook for an additional 10-15 minutes until the dumplings are fluffy and cooked through.
- Serve hot and enjoy the warm, aromatic flavors of this Asian-inspired stew!
Rustic Turkey Stew With Root Vegetable Dumplings

Rustic Turkey Stew with Root Vegetable Dumplings is a hearty and comforting dish that combines tender chunks of turkey with a savory broth and wholesome root vegetables. This stew, perfect for chilly evenings, features rich flavors and nourishing ingredients. The fluffy root vegetable dumplings elevate this dish further, making it a filling meal that warms both the body and soul.
| Ingredients | Quantity |
|---|---|
| Cooked turkey meat | 2 cups, cubed |
| Chicken broth | 4 cups |
| Onion | 1, chopped |
| Carrots | 2, diced |
| Potatoes | 2, peeled and cubed |
| Celery | 2 stalks, chopped |
| Garlic | 3 cloves, minced |
| Thyme | 1 teaspoon |
| Bay leaf | 1 |
| Salt | To taste |
| Black pepper | To taste |
| All-purpose flour | 2 cups |
| Baking powder | 1 tablespoon |
| Milk | 1 cup |
| Egg | 1 |
| Parsnips | 1, peeled and diced |
Cooking Steps:
- In a large pot, sauté onion, carrots, celery, and garlic until softened.
- Add turkey, potatoes, chicken broth, thyme, bay leaf, salt, and pepper; bring to a simmer.
- Cover and let cook for 30 minutes, stirring occasionally.
- In a separate bowl, combine flour, baking powder, milk, and egg to create a dumpling dough; fold in diced parsnips.
- Drop spoonfuls of the dumpling mixture into the simmering stew.
- Cover and cook for an additional 15-20 minutes until the dumplings are cooked through and fluffy.
- Serve warm for a hearty and comforting meal!
